At Charkha Tales, every saree carries a story, and this Red Madhubani Silk Saree is a celebration of India’s living art traditions. Inspired by the age-old Madhubani art of Bihar, this saree brings together detailed hand painting and luxurious silk in a truly timeless form.

Madhubani art is known for its storytelling motifs...nature, symbols, rituals, and everyday life—painted carefully using fine brushes and steady hands. On this saree, the artwork is done by skilled artisans who follow traditional techniques passed down through generations. Each motif is painted patiently, making every piece unique and full of character. The rich red shade adds warmth and depth, making it a powerful yet graceful choice for special occasions.

Crafted from silk, the saree has a soft sheen and smooth texture that drapes beautifully. It feels light yet luxurious, allowing easy movement while maintaining a refined look. Natural variations in the artwork are part of its handmade charm and remind you that no two sarees are ever the same.
